But before we get into the benefits of going plant-based with your shampoo, conditioner and styling products, you might question why you even need to consider it at all. The reality is, animal derivatives are included in many hair care products.
Shampoos containing ingredients like keratin, collagen and honey, all of which are made from animal byproducts, aren’t vegan. Similarly, while a cruelty-free stamp means the product hasn’t been tested on animals, it doesn’t mean there aren’t animal products in the formulation. Vegan ingredient swaps your hair loves
To smooth away frizz, leave hair glossy, strong and manageable SWAP non-vegan keratin for hemp seed oil
Hemp seed oil is rich in om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ids, which lubricate your hair, preventing breakage and nourishing every strand. To fight damage, prevent thinning and help hair grow healthy SWAP collagen for nature’s ‘liquid gold’ argan oil
This Moroccan must-have is full of plant-based fatty acids and antioxidants, so it delivers moisture deep into the strands and helps your hair to maintain it, while also protecting against daily damage, including heat styling. To hydrate hair while also helping to keep your scalp happy SWAP non-vegan glycerin for algae
Algae is an excellent non-animal ingredient that delivers impressive hydration. It’s especially great if you have thick, dehydrated hair. To strengthen and hydrate with antibacterial powers SWAP honey for coconut oil
Coconut oil really is one of the best hydrators out there; made up of medium-chain fatty acid lauric acid, your hair soaks it up for powerful moisturization, as well as limiting protein loss (just like honey), improving the structure of your strands.
